28/04/2015 - Debate on The Legislative Programme

The item started at 15.57

 

Voting on the motion and amendments under this item was deferred until Voting Time.

 

NDM5744 Jane Hutt (Vale of Glamorgan)

 

To propose that the National Assembly for Wales:

 

Notes the Welsh Government's Legislative Programme.

 

The following amendments were tabled:

 

Amendment 1 - Paul Davies (Preseli Pembrokeshire)

 

After 'programme', insert:

 

'but regrets the lack of ambition in it.'

 

A vote was taken on Amendment 1:

Amendment 1 was not agreed.

 

Amendment 2 - Elin Jones (Ceredigion)

 

Add as new point at end of motion:

 

Recognises that the success of the legislative programme relies on a sustainable funding mechanism for the Welsh Government.

 

A vote was taken on Amendment 2:

Amendment 2 was agreed.

 

Amendment 3 - Aled Robert (North Wales)

 

Add as new point at end of motion:

 

Calls for the Welsh Government to introduce within the remainder of this Assembly term legislation requiring all nursery staff to complete an officially recognised paediatric first aid course.

 

A vote was taken on Amendment 3:

Amendment 3 was not agreed.

 

A vote was taken on the motion as amended:

 

NDM5744 Jane Hutt (Vale of Glamorgan)

 

To propose that the National Assembly for Wales:

 

1. Notes the Welsh Government's Legislative Programme.

 

2. Recognises that the success of the legislative programme relies on a sustainable funding mechanism for the Welsh Government.
